Mid-Jordan/Draper Design Build Utah Transit Authority PROGRAM VALUE LOCATION $230,000,000 Salt Lake City, Utah Parsons is the engineer-of-record for the Mid-Jordan Light Rail Transit project, one of the first segments of the Utah Transit Authority s 2015 rail construction program to get under way. The project involves the design and construction of 10.6 miles of double track with its associated overhead catenary, 10 stations, five bridges, three box culverts, eight retaining walls, extensive soundwalls, and a portal underneath the Union Pacific Railroad mainlines. Parsons has been the lead designer on the track, systems, structures, civil, grading, utilities, and park-and-ride lots. Once completed, the light rail line will ease traffic and improve air quality in the rapidly growing southern end of Salt Lake County. 3
Tacoma Narrows Bridge Washington State Department of Transportation PROGRAM VALUE LOCATION $615,000,000 Pierce County, Washington Parsons was the engineer-of-record for the first suspension bridge delivered using the design-build method in the United States. Our scope included design of a third suspension bridge across the Puget Sound s Tacoma Narrows, upgraded design for the existing suspension bridge, and design of 2.5 miles of roadway and toll operations facilities. By implementing the engineering design, we eliminated a tunnel and reduced grading work, delivering this fast-track project ahead of schedule and under budget. The new bridge designed to accommodate a future lower level for light rail or highway lanes improves safety, adds capacity, provides a bicycle/ pedestrian path, and enhances access to outlying communities. This project won several regional and national awards, including an Excellence Achievement Award from the National Safety Council. Southeast Corridor Transportation Expansion (T-REX) Colorado Department of Transportation and Regional Transportation District PROGRAM VALUE LOCATION $1,670,000,000 Denver, Colorado As part of a joint venture, Parsons was the design lead on this reconstruction and expansion project the nation s largest multimodal effort. Our innovative design of the I-25/I-225 interchange resulted in cost savings, improved aesthetics, and enhanced safety and maintenance aspects. This multiple award-winning project was completed 22 months ahead of the owner s schedule and ended with a 92 percent approval rating toward the project goal of minimizing inconvenience to the public. Kicking Horse Canyon Trans Park Highway Group PROGRAM VALUE LOCATION $125,000,000 (CAN) Golden, British Columbia, Canada In this joint venture, Parsons designed and constructed a new bridge and roadway improvements for a 5.8-km stretch of the Trans Canada Highway through Kicking Horse Canyon, located in the rugged terrain of the Canadian Rocky Mountains. The selected design reduced sharp curves and steep grades, as well as increased capacity from two to four lanes, while preserving the scenic resources of the canyon. Despite technically challenging site conditions and inclement weather, the construction time line was reduced by several months. Our team s innovative solutions, including construction engineering for the new bridge across the canyon, saved millions of dollars on this fast-track program. 5

Parsons is responsible for designing, building, supplying vehicles, operating, and maintaining this significant light rail expansion project. The initial phase of the $1.46 billion program includes utility work, 6.4 miles of light rail, a light rail overpass, a service and inspection facility, and the purchase of 29 light rail vehicles. A substantial portion of the initial design-build work is expected to be subcontracted to local small and disadvantaged business enterprises. This project represents an innovative and collaborative approach to project delivery in the transit market. When construction is completed, Parsons will provide operation and maintenance for a period of five years. 6

Under a joint venture, Parsons served as the construction manager at-risk for the new South Terminal, a five-story, 1.7-million-sq.-ft. facility; a new 14-gate, 360,000-sq.-ft. concourse; refurbishment of Concourse H; and enhanced baggagehandling and security screening facilities. Our team managed 11 small business subcontractors and six major trade subcontractors while achieving a strong safety record and maintaining the schedule even when the events of September 11, 2001, triggered new security system requirements. The new terminal, which opened for its inaugural flight in August 2007, includes a Federal Inspection Service area that can process 2,000 international passengers an hour safely, swiftly, and securely. 8
